    Abstract

    A goalie helmet has a head protective outer shell which is configured to circumscribe the head of a goalie. The shell has an interior space in which a floating head framing member is located for cradling and supporting the head of the goalie. The head framing member is located in spaced relation to and a given distance from the back or rear section of the shell of the helmet. Attachment devices, such as straps, connect the head framing member to the helmet in spaced relation to and a distance away from the rear section. The helmet also includes a unique chin cup support bracket located on its lower front section. A specifically designed chin cup is configured to be removeably positioned and secured onto the bracket. The chin cup can simply and easily be replaced on the bracket when it becomes worn.

    DETAILED DESCRIPTION OF THE INVENTION

    [0011] Goalie helmet 1 of the present invention is a major improvement over existing commonly worn helmets. FIGS. 2-6 show various views of helmet 1. For the sake of simplicity and clarity of invention, helmet 1 is shown without the protective padding which normally would be found within a goalie's helmet.

    [0012] With particular reference to FIG. 3, helmet 1 comprises head protective outer shell 2 designed to circumscribe the goalie's head. Shell 2 comprises lower front section 4, top section 6, and rear section 8, extending from the top section down to the bottom 10 of helmet 1, which approximates where the neck area of the wearer. Lower front section 4, top section 6, and rear section 8 of shell 2 encloses interior space 14 of helmet 1. A plurality of air circulating holes 15 extend through shell 2. Front window 12, protected by cage 16, is provided at the front of helmet 1.

    [0013] Floating head framing member 20 is elliptically shaped to conform to the back of the head of the wearer. Its purpose is to cradle and provide rigid support to the head. Framing member 20 is advantageously located within interior space 14, in spaced relation to and a given distance away from rear section 8 of shell 2. Framing member 20 is maintained in this position, in spaced relation to and a given distance away from rear section 8, by attachment means in the form of a plurality of length adjustable straps 22, 23, 24, 25 and 26 which extend between the framing member and shell 2, through openings 27, 28, 29, 30 and 31 in the shell. The adjustability of the straps provides the means to adjust the position of framing member 20 within interior space 14, in order to accommodate the position and comfort of the head of the wearer. There is thus increased support and stability for the head, thereby vastly increasing the protection and safety of the wearer.

    [0014] Of significance is that strap 22, the top strap which secures framing member 20, comprises a non-elastic, non-stretchable material. This is critical to maintaining the position of the framing member, as an elastic material would allow helmet 1 to unduly move about and droop over the wearer's head. In fact, the non-elastic nature of strap 22 allows framing member 20 to pivot back and forth, almost like a hinge, while being worn by the goalie.

    [0015] It is further noted that openings 27, 28, 29, 30 and 31 are large enough to allow them to be unsnapped and removed, without being cut, when removal of helmet 1 is necessary, should the goalie be injured and unconscious.

    [0016] The positioning of framing member 20, a spaced apart distance from rear section 8 of shell 2 and the control opening of the framing member also allow for increased air flow around the wearer's head. Overheating is greatly reduced, enhancing the comfort of the wearer.

    [0017] Chin cup support bracket 40 is attached by means of screws 42 and 43 to the interior of lower front section 4 of shell 2. As seen in FIG. 2, these screws also secure the lower section of cage 16 to shell 2, by means of cage clips. Chin cup support bracket 40 comprises base member 44 and dual arm members 46 and 48, upstanding from the base member. Chin cup 50 is designed to be removeably positioned and maintained within chin cup support bracket 40. Slots 52 and 54 are located through chin cup 50. Arm members 46 and 48 are configured to extend through slots 52 and 54 in order to maintain chin cup 50 within chin cup support bracket 40. In this way chin cup 50 can easily and readily be removed from and replaced on chin cup support bracket 40, when the chin cup becomes worn or otherwise ineffective. The use of chin cup support bracket 40 and its corresponding chin cup 50 serves to further eliminate play by comfortably stabilizing the wearer's chin within helmet 1.
